Enum lldb_sys::SymbolType[][src]

#[repr(u32)]
pub enum SymbolType {
Show variants Any, Absolute, Code, Resolver, Data, Trampoline, Runtime, Exception, SourceFile, HeaderFile, ObjectFile, CommonBlock, Block, Local, Param, Variable, VariableType, LineEntry, LineHeader, ScopeBegin, ScopeEnd, Additional, Compiler, Instrumentation, Undefined, ObjCClass, ObjCMetaClass, ObjCIVar, ReExported,
}

Variants

Any
Absolute
Code
Resolver
Data
Trampoline
Runtime
Exception
SourceFile
HeaderFile
ObjectFile
CommonBlock
Block
Local
Param
Variable
VariableType
LineEntry
LineHeader
ScopeBegin
ScopeEnd
Additional
Compiler
Instrumentation
Undefined
ObjCClass
ObjCMetaClass
ObjCIVar
ReExported

Trait Implementations

impl Clone for SymbolType[src]

impl Copy for SymbolType[src]

impl Debug for SymbolType[src]

impl PartialEq<SymbolType> for SymbolType[src]

impl PartialOrd<SymbolType> for SymbolType[src]

impl StructuralPartialEq for SymbolType[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.